Ive been doing a little research and it appears that there are two versions of this frame, with different gusset plates at the headstay. Below are two examples, both 2018 frames:

Standard gusset at steering head:



Larger gusset:



You can see how the larger gusset runs further out onto the head and has a much longer weld. This is similar to what the 19 frame looks like in this area. 19 might go even further. On the 19, the gussets that connect the frame downtube to the cross member are larger as well.

Anyway,I would make sure youre new frame looks like the bottom pic and not like the top, which is just like yours.
